homemade salad dressingSalad dressings from the store have sugar or other sweeteners, high fructose corn syrup, soybean oil (which is heavily laden with pesticides) and a variety of preservatives. Try these simple and delicious recipes to make a healthy homemade dressing for your salad.

Red Wine Vinaigrette

  • ¼ cup red wine vinegar
  • 2 tsp water
  • ½ tsp Dijon mustard
  • 1 – 2 cloves minced garlic
  • ½ tsp salt
  • ¾ cup extra virgin olive oil
  • ¼ tsp freshly ground pepper

Chive and Yogurt Dressing

  • ¾ cup extra virgin olive oil
  • ¼ cup lemon juice
  • ½ cup plain unsweetened yogurt
  • 1 – 2 cloves minced garlic
  • bunch of chives, chopped
  • salt and pepper to taste

Asian Salad Dressing

  • ¼ cup tamari or soy sauce
  • ¼ cup red wine vinegar (or basalmic vinegar)
  • ½ cup extra virgin olive oil
  • 2 tbsp toasted sesame oil
  • 3 tsp pureed ginger
  • handful of chopped cilantro (optional)

Mix ingredients thoroughly, and taste. Don’t be afraid to adjust amounts, add your favorite herbs and substitute ingredients according to taste. Experiment!
